Hanover Park removes village manager residency requirement and begins recruitment process
Summary
Trustees amended municipal code section 2‑172 to remove the requirement that the village manager be a resident and made related gender‑neutral edits; staff said the change allows MGT to finalize the recruitment brochure and begin a roughly four‑month recruitment cycle before the current manager's last day.
On June 5 the Hanover Park Board voted to modify Chapter 2, Section 2‑172 of the municipal code to remove the requirement that the village manager be a resident of the village and to update pronoun references to use the title "village manager." Trustees said the change modernizes the code and expands the candidate pool for recruitment.
